Contact Tredit the wheel supplier. If you are the original owner, the wheels have a lifetime guarantee. They will ask for pics and a form to be filled out, but they will ship a new wheel and reimburse you for having the tire swapped to the new wheel. Also you must send the defective wheel back to them (prepaid), in the same box.

Contacting Tredit is the right idea but not necessary to be the original owner. Have had 2 replaced in last 4 years and am a second owner and Tredit is aware of this.
